Este é um tutorial para iniciantes sobre como usar adereços. É importante que você entenda o que é desestruturação e como usar/criar componentes antes de ler.
Props, abreviação de propriedades, props nos permitem enviar informações de componentes pais para componentes filhos, também é importante observar que eles podem ser de qualquer tipo de dados.
É fundamental entender a sintaxe para criar uma propriedade para qualquer um de seus componentes. No React, você deve usar a mesma sintaxe para escrever um atributo para uma tag html. A forma como especificamos uma propriedade é colocando-a dentro do nosso elemento assim:
ParentPlant() { return}
Uma boa regra a ser lembrada ao criar Props é: strings não precisam ter chaves em torno de seu valor, fazemos isso apenas para outros tipos de dados. Como você pode ver acima, podemos ter uma infinidade de adereços atribuindo-os ao componente pai. Quando temos nossos adereços em nosso componente, é importante saber que tecnicamente os estamos passando-os. Depois de passarmos nossos adereços, precisaremos ser capazes de recebê-los dentro do componente desejado. Neste caso, nosso componente ChildPlant.
Recebendo acessórios:
function ChildPlant(props) { return ( {props.text} {props.number} > ) }
Estamos fazendo as coisas aqui: 1. Estamos recebendo nossa prop dentro do parâmetro de nosso componente ChildPlant, 2. Estamos desestruturando os valores de nossa prop por meio do nome de nossa prop. É importante saber que nossos adereços não são um parâmetro, mas sim funções semelhantes a um.
A única maneira de passar os dados do componente pai para o componente filho é por meio de adereços. Gosto de pensar nisso como o DNA, um componente parental contém aspectos de si mesmo que já existem dentro dele. Como essa criança também pode ter aspectos do DNA de seus pais, os adereços funcionam como o ativador que torna o cabelo da criança ruivo, preto ou loiro.
Os adereços são recebidos na função filho e enviados por meio da função pai, mas os adereços só podem ser enviados e nunca enviados de volta. Também podemos pensar nos adereços como objetos. Isso ocorre porque eles essencialmente contêm dados semelhantes a pares chave-valor. Para voltar ao motivo pelo qual eles são semelhantes aos parâmetros, eles armazenam vários objetos dentro deles. Gosto de pensar na área onde os adereços são recebidos como espaços reservados. Eles ocupam espaço para algum objeto que queremos compartilhar com nosso componente e trocam quando precisamos, por meio de desestruturação e notação de ponto.
Esta é uma boa maneira de visualizá-lo:
Aqui podemos visualizar adereços contendo tudo dentro de nossas caixas quadradas, cada um contendo seu respectivo valor de dados do nosso primeiro exemplo. Agora apenas usamos nosso método de desestruturação para obter o valor de nossa propriedade. E é assim que usar adereços em poucas palavras!
Isenção de responsabilidade: Todos os recursos fornecidos são parcialmente provenientes da Internet. Se houver qualquer violação de seus direitos autorais ou outros direitos e interesses, explique os motivos detalhados e forneça prova de direitos autorais ou direitos e interesses e envie-a para o e-mail: [email protected]. Nós cuidaremos disso para você o mais rápido possível.
Copyright© 2022 湘ICP备2022001581号-3